Spatial Consultants working with TfL Enterprise Architecture Team

6th January 2008

Spatial Consultants start working with Transport for London to provide architectural direction for the development of a corporate geospatial data management platform. The new platform will provide access to geospatial capabilities across TfL and will enable data to be shared efficiently and securely across transport modes. Solution architectures will also be developed for a number of business projects (including Legible London pedestrian navigation and bus incident reporting).

Transport for London (TfL) is the local government body responsible for most aspects of the transport system in Greater London in England. Its role is to implement the transport strategy and to manage transport services across London. Online at http://www.tfl.gov.uk
